Transaction 3ec78c576cfabc983991c50a7dfe9940850d445fe785e1e49bf1b7b847976700
1 Input
2 Outputs
- 3ec78c576cfabc983991c50a7dfe9940850d445fe785e1e49bf1b7b847976700:0
- 3ec78c576cfabc983991c50a7dfe9940850d445fe785e1e49bf1b7b847976700:1
value 16202262
address 3HPWUd5RxZRGedxbfSuTf3L4ZCnsEr2W5D
value 10598065
address 132mJuhAkZdvA1hLhcGNCJH9PX9fVanZiW